The Anthem: "I Get The Bag" Featuring Migos
Released in 2017 as part of Gucci Mane's eleventh studio album, "Mr. Davis," "I Get The Bag" featuring Migos quickly became a chart-topping hit and a cultural phenomenon. The song's infectious beat, coupled with Gucci Mane's signature drawl and Migos's signature triplet flow, created a perfect storm of sonic energy that resonated with audiences worldwide.
The lyrics, while relatively straightforward, are packed with braggadocio and declarations of financial prowess. Gucci Mane lays down the foundation, rapping about his wealth, success, and relentless pursuit of money. Lines like "I get the bag and flip it and tumble it" and "I get the bag and spend it and double it" are simple yet effective, illustrating the cycle of earning, investing, and multiplying wealth.
Migos, known for their unique ad-libs and intricate rhyme schemes, further amplify the song's message. Quavo, Takeoff, and Offset each contribute verses that boast about their opulent lifestyles, designer clothes, and ability to consistently "get the bag." The collective energy of Gucci Mane and Migos creates a sense of undeniable confidence and serves as an aspirational blueprint for listeners.
Lyrical Breakdown: More Than Just Money
While the surface level of "I Get The Bag" is undoubtedly about money, a closer examination reveals deeper themes of hard work, dedication, and resilience. The song isn't just about inheriting wealth; it's about actively pursuing it. Gucci Mane, who has overcome significant personal and professional challenges, embodies this message. His journey from the streets to the top of the music industry is a testament to his unwavering determination and commitment to "getting the bag."
The lyrics also touch upon the importance of smart financial decisions. The phrase "flip it and tumble it" suggests a strategic approach to investing and growing wealth. It's not just about earning money; it's about making that money work for you. This underlying message of financial literacy adds another layer of depth to the song and makes it more than just a superficial celebration of wealth.

The Gucci Connection: More Than Just a Brand
The name "Gucci" carries significant weight in the world of fashion and luxury. Founded in Florence, Italy, in 1921, Gucci has become synonymous with high-quality craftsmanship, innovative designs, and unparalleled prestige. The brand's iconic logo and signature patterns are instantly recognizable and represent a symbol of status and sophistication.get to the bag gucci
The connection between Gucci Mane and the Gucci brand is more than just a name coincidence. Gucci Mane's unapologetic embrace of luxury and his association with high-end fashion have helped to further popularize the brand among a younger audience. His music often references Gucci clothing, accessories, and lifestyle, blurring the lines between music, fashion, and culture.
